This DIY programming socket allows you to program SOIC16 300mil wide ICs without soldering or expensive sockets. Simply insert 0.75mm diameter wires with 8mm stripped ends into the side holes, ensuring the insulation jams in the hole. The first prototype serves as a proof-of-concept for an eventual universal programming kit in combination with a PCB and holder set. Secure the cover with M3 screws, which can be improved with a manual clip featuring a spring. Print at 40mm/s using 0.15mm layers on an Ultimaker for optimal precision.
